Huadian Shanshan Solar PV Park is a ground-mounted solar project which is spread over an area of 2,367 acres. The project generates 173,000MWh electricity thereby offsetting 142,700t of carbon
Shanshan Solar PV Park is a 20MW solar PV power project. It is located in Xinjiang Uyghur Autonomous Region, China.
The project is located in Qiketai Town, Shanshan County, Turpan City, Xinjiang Uygur Autonomous Region.
